Alcorn McBride Aids Perot Museum’s ‘Shale Voyager’ Experience

DALLAS – In the new Perot Museum of Nature and Science in Dallas, the Tom Hunt Energy Hall’s 4D Theater experience, “Shale Voyager,” is controlled by Alcorn McBride’s V4 Pro show controller and 8-channel Digital Binloop HD player. Video and motion chairs give visitors the sense of what it would be like to shrink to the size of a grape, travel vertically down a 6,500-foot borehole, come out horizontally through the black rock of North Texas’s Barnett Shale and whoosh back to the surface when the gas is released.

Schnick Schnack Adds Accent to ‘The Voice’

LOS ANGELES – Schnick Schnack Systems LED accent lighting literally spins with the hot seats on NBC’s ‘The Voice.’  Chosen by designer Oscar Dominguez of Darkfire Lighting Design, Schnick Schnack Systems’ camera-friendly, calibrated colors light the triangular podium on the front of each judge’s chair. Whenever a critical red decision button is pushed, the LEDs behind the Plexiglas podium change colors and the chair spins around.

Projection Studio Creates ‘Illuminata’ Video Install at Welsh Castle

WALES – Ross Ashton and The Projection Studio have designed and coordinated a permanent 270 degree video projection installation featuring an adaptation of their successful work ‘Illuminata’ at Caerphilly Castle in Wales for CADW, the official guardian of the built heritage of Wales. The installed looped show with accompanying soundtrack is 10 minutes long.

Robe Installed At Stockholm’s Sodra Teatern

STOCKHOLM – Södra Teatern (Southern Theatre) located in Stockholm’s lively Söder district, is one of Sweden’s best known privately run theatres and the oldest such venue in Stockholm, established in 1859. The newest Robe fixtures in the house as part of a general lighting upgrade are six LEDWash 600s and four LEDWash 300s, specified by Head of Lighting Lars Ekdahl.

Barten Depends on GLP for 2013 MOD Awards

LAS VEGAS – Barten Production Services recently provided technology reinforcement for the 2013 MOD Awards at the Four Seasons Hotel in Las Vegas, with the set design depending on GLP’s Volkslicht Zoom and Impression Spot One LED fixtures. The MOD Awards honor the best in the modular exhibit industry.

Indiana Pacers Score with Spyder-Powered Video Board

INDIANAPOLIS – The NBA’s Indiana Pacers have unveiled a new center-hung video board at the Bankers Life Fieldhouse designed to deliver an experience fans just can’t get at home – and a Spyder is a big part of it.  ANC Sports Enterprises integrated the Vista Systems Spyder X20 to feed the new displays with entertainment, informative content for Pacers fans. The display is more than five times larger than the previous video board.

Burross Receives HES Lifetime Achievement Award

AUSTIN, TX – High End Systems National Sales Manager Craig Burross was recently presented an award from his peers and company founders for his achievement of $200 million in sales of High End Systems products. Burross joined High End Systems in March 1991, and was instrumental in the company’s sales of Intellabeam HX, Trackspot, Cyberlight, Studio Color and other products in the US. Burross says he is continuing to work on his next $200 million for the company.
